当前位置: 首页 > news >正文

龙泉做网站哪家好网站收录查询

龙泉做网站哪家好,网站收录查询,html网站的直播怎么做的,策划网站建设雪花算法是什么 不多解释。看一看 具体是怎么 生产 唯一ID 的。 ID 由多个数据组合拼接成64位,分别是 时间戳 服务器节点ID 序列号,每个数据项占的位数不固定,可以根据实际需求设置。首位 1 个二进制位 是 符号位。 public long allocate(l…

雪花算法是什么 不多解释。看一看 具体是怎么 生产 唯一ID 的。

ID 由多个数据组合拼接成64位,分别是 时间戳 + 服务器节点ID + 序列号,每个数据项占的位数不固定,可以根据实际需求设置。首位 1 个二进制位 是 符号位。

public long allocate(long deltaSeconds, long workerId, long sequence) {return (deltaSeconds << timestampShift) | (workerId << workerIdShift) | sequence;}

将时间戳,节点ID,序列号 三个 long 型的 数字 进行 移位 和  按位或 运算,就得到最终的UID

移位 和 按位或 操作 都是 二进制 位操作,操作的对象 是 一个 二进制位 0或者1

对于十进制的 long 型 数值,移位操作 是 先转为 二进制数 再进行移位操作 

所以,时间戳移位 的结果  和 服务器节点ID 移位的结果 进行 按位或运行。那么,结果是 时间戳戳 和 服务器节点ID 组合再一起获得一个 long 型数值。

比如

十进制 58208484 

64位二进制为:

000000000000000000000000000000000000 0011 0111 1000 0011 0000 1110 0100

左移 33位:

000 0011 0111 1000 0011 0000 1110 0100 000000000000000000000000000000000

十进制  267

64位二进制为:

0000000000000000000000000000000000000000000000000000 0010 0110 0111

左移 13位

000000000000000000000000000000000000000 0010 0110 0111 0000000000000

再进行 或操作,转为 十进制即可。

 

http://www.yidumall.com/news/31586.html

相关文章:

  • 金泉网普通会员可以建设网站吗网络营销优化
  • 北京搜索引擎推广系统搜索引擎优化要考虑哪些方面
  • 陕西省建设执业注册中心网站公司网站建设服务机构
  • 做修图网站电脑配置网络推广员工作好做吗
  • 招聘网站开发学徒2021年经典营销案例
  • 智能建造师证书有用吗比较好的网络优化公司
  • 网站怎么做视频百度手机卫士
  • 自学web前端能找到工作吗seo企业优化顾问
  • 庞各庄网站建设优秀的网页设计案例
  • 旅游网站html5代码模板夸克搜索引擎
  • 舟山网站制作网页制作代码
  • 做网站怎么接广告赚钱拓客软件排行榜
  • 柳州企业做网站西安seo外包优化
  • 企业网站方案设计小红书搜索指数
  • 毕业设计网站代做多少钱汉中网络推广
  • 公司注册流程步骤图青岛设计优化公司
  • 青岛网景互联网站建设公司郑州seo优化顾问阿亮
  • 章丘灵通环保设备在哪个网站上做的中国域名注册局官网
  • 多语言版本的网站电子商务网站建设规划方案
  • 如何做网站的后台管理军事新闻俄乌最新消息
  • 建工报名网seo定义
  • 网站做营利性广告需要什么备案常熟seo关键词优化公司
  • 可以查授权的网站怎么做爱网站
  • 怎样花钱做网站赚钱百度竞价推广登录入口
  • dede拷贝其他网站文章网站建站
  • wordpress 安装要求seo推广小分享
  • 怎么查网站的关键词排名品牌建设
  • 石碣做网站优化福州百度网站排名优化
  • 脚踏垃圾桶移动网站建设做网络销售如何找客户
  • 做网站域名费向哪里交阿里巴巴国际站运营